Output 1590c20ccad64bcac3a32f38751d366ff65bd511950906191550f6adae3b8255:1

value
9886764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4383651216a8a8e2beb48fcd0198edcecbc06b7f OP_EQUAL
address
37qzbsH2iApF7thqMsf6XFYYpTf4KPbnZb
transaction
1590c20ccad64bcac3a32f38751d366ff65bd511950906191550f6adae3b8255
spent
true